Why do so many creative, ambitious people struggle to finish what they start? Discovering the answer might transform your approach to every project you undertake.
This episode dives deep into the psychology behind our tendency to abandon projects before completion. We explore how starting something new often feels exciting and full of possibility, while the vulnerability of finishing exposes us to potential criticism and rejection. That pattern of constant pivoting to new ideas—which seems like creativity or adaptability—might actually be a sophisticated form of self-protection.
